Senior Quality Assurance Manager Japan
Yesterday• Tokyo, Japan
We are seeking an experienced Senior Quality Assurance Manager to lead and maintain our local Quality Management System, ensuring compliance with local regulations and global CSL Behring standards. This role is responsible for driving quality excellence across the affiliate, providing strategic quality leadership, supporting product lifecycle activities, managing supplier oversight, and partnering cross-functionally with local, regional, and global stakeholders to foster a strong quality culture and ensure the highest standards of patient safety and product quality.
Reporting to QA Head Japan
Roles & Responsibilities
- Implementation and maintenance of the Quality Management System in compliance with local regulations and CSLB standards, including but not limited to: Deviation Management o Corrective Action & Preventive Action (CAPA) Management, Product Complaints Management, Change Control Management, Documentation Management, Training Management, Recall Management, Self-Inspection Management, Quality Risk Management and recommendation for improvements to the quality system supporting CSLB business in the countries
- Implementation of the Quality Systems in daily operations: Quality responsibility for all CSLB products licensed, marketed, or supplied within Territory of responsibility, Compliance with local as well as international regulations (e.g. GDP) and inspection readiness, Obtain/oversee the legal documentation required license to operate in the Territory, Maintain up-to-date Quality Agreements, Develop, implement, and maintain local Quality procedural documentation (in accordance with Global policies and procedures and the local document management system, if required), Monitor performance indicators related to quality compliance, Resolve quality-related issues, Archive and maintain all quality documents in line with CSLB procedures and legal requirements

Qualifications, Skills & Experience
- Degree in pharmacy or life science (if required by local legislation) or equivalent experience
- At least 10 years of experience in the pharmaceutical industry, of which 5 years of experience in Quality Management Systems
- Fluent in local language and good knowledge of oral and written English
- Understands and has experience in pharmaceutical quality assurance systems
- Knowledge of Good Distribution Practices (GDP),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P), and local regulations and guidelines as applicable to the level of activities carried out at the affiliate or region
- Sound and balanced judgment; able to assess and handle risks; self-confident, proactive, and decisive
- Works and communicates effectively and collaboratively across affiliate functions and other global CSL functions and external partners or third parties
About CSL Behring
CSL Behring is a global biotherapeutics leader driven by our promise to save lives. Focused on serving patients' needs by using the latest technologies, we discover, develop and deliver innovative therapies for people living with conditions in the immunology, hematology, cardiovascular and metabolic, respiratory, and transplant therapeutic areas. We use three strategic scientific platforms of plasma fractionation, recombinant protein technology, and cell and gene therapy to support continued innovation and continually refine ways in which products can address unmet medical needs and help patients lead full lives.
CSL Behring operates one of the world's largest plasma collection networks, CSL Plasma. Our parent company, CSL, headquartered in Melbourne, Australia, employs 32,000 people, and delivers its lifesaving therapies to people in more than 100 countries.
